"...Powell "continually reassured his listeners that this wasn't simply best guessing and estimation; he kept repeating, 'These are things we know,' " says Greg Thielmann, former director of the Office of Analysis of Strategic, Proliferation, and Military Issues in the State Department's Bureau of Intelligence and Research. He retired in fall 2002. "That simply wasn't true. ... There's no other way to describe the language used by Secretary Powell other than to say it was misleading the public and other countries in the world."..."
